Andrew Penn appointed Chief Financial Officer

14 December 2011 – Telstra today announced that Andrew Penn has been appointed Chief Financial Officer and Group Managing Director, Finance, from 1 March 2012.

Mr Penn is an experienced chief executive and chief financial officer with a career spanning more than thirty years, the past twenty at AXA Asia Pacific in a variety of finance, strategy and executive roles, most recently Group Chief Executive.

“I am delighted to welcome Andy to this critical position. Andy has extensive experience in Australia and overseas, a proven track record of success as a Chief Financial Officer, and a demonstrated ability to create shareholder value in complex businesses,” Chief Executive Officer David Thodey said.

Mr Penn was Group CEO of AXA Asia Pacific from 2006 until 2011. Over twenty years at AXA he held a variety of roles including CEO of the Australia and New Zealand business, Chief Operations Officer, Head of Transformation, and Chief Executive of Asia. He previously held roles at the P&O Shipping Group.

Most of Mr Penn’s previous roles have had strong corporate finance responsibilities. He has successfully led value-adding transactions in Australia, New Zealand, Europe, North America and across Asia.

Mr Penn will be a member of Telstra’s CEO leadership team and will report to Mr Thodey. He will be based in Melbourne.

“"I am looking forward to joining the team at Telstra and I am very excited by this great opportunity in a dynamic industry,” Mr Penn said.

Telstra also announced that Mark Hall will be acting Chief Financial Officer and Group Managing Director, Finance, from 1 January to 29 February 2012. Mr Hall is currently Deputy CFO.

Mr Thodey thanked retiring CFO, John Stanhope, for his service to the company over a career spanning more than four decades, including eight years as Chief Financial Officer and Group Managing Director, Finance & Administration.

“On behalf of his colleagues, I would like to acknowledge John’s enormous contribution to our company over four decades, and wish him and his family the very best for the future,” Mr Thodey concluded.

BIOGRAPHY – ANDREW PENN

Andrew (Andy) Penn is an experienced chief executive and chief financial officer with a career spanning more than thirty years, the past twenty at AXA Asia Pacific in a variety of finance, strategy and executive roles, most recently Group Chief Executive.

Over twenty years at AXA Asia Pacific he has served as Group CEO (2006-2011), Chief Executive Officer for Australia & NZ (2004-06), Group Chief Financial Officer (2002-04), Chief Operations Officer for Australia & NZ and Head of Transformation (2000-02), Chief Executive for Asia (1998-2000), Business Development & Operations for Asia (1992-98), and Strategy Manager for Europe (1990-92).

Prior to joining AXA, Andy worked in London with the P&O Shipping Group in a variety of roles.

In addition to his business activities, Andy has contributed widely to not-for-profit and community organisations. He is a director of the Juvenile Diabetes Research Foundation Advisory Council, and The Big Issue Advisory Group. He is Chairman and foundation board member of Very Special Kids, and is an Amy Gillet Foundation Ambassador.

Andy was born in the United Kingdom and migrated to Australia in 1992. He has four children and lives in Melbourne.
